8,866 Steps to Miles, By Height

The 2,000-steps-per-mile figure above is a flat average. Stride length actually scales with height, so the same 8,866 steps covers a different distance depending on how tall the walker is.

HeightDistance
Short (~5'2")3.59 mi
Average (~5'7")3.88 mi
Tall (~6'2")4.29 mi

Where 8,866 Steps Ranks

Activity levels are commonly grouped by daily step count. Here's where 8,866 steps falls.

Activity LevelDaily Steps
SedentaryUnder 5,000
Low Active5,000–7,499
Somewhat Active7,500–9,999
Active10,000–12,499
Highly Active12,500+

Did You Know?

1

The word "mile" comes from the Latin mille passus, a thousand paces. A Roman pace wasn't one footstep though, it was a full left-right stride cycle, so a Roman mile actually worked out to around 2,000 individual steps, the same ballpark this calculator uses today.

2

At its peak, the Roman road network stretched over 250,000 miles, with stone milestones planted every thousand paces so army commanders could calculate march times. It's one of the earliest large-scale uses of a standardized steps-to-distance conversion.
